Output 3768df1b5c15a2101d198506b6d763c873bff9d859305e76763912a606a993c5:6

value
21219531
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afe274365f3e09cec6b3bb92ed4a31f9db2728e5 OP_EQUALVERIFY OP_CHECKSIG
address
1H2zXsHN72T65DMf39Acm2C7KJC5RkpRqL
transaction
3768df1b5c15a2101d198506b6d763c873bff9d859305e76763912a606a993c5
confirmations
574492
spent
true